Meet the Devs: Android Developer Alliance

Sep 20 2012 05:45 PM | BearDroid in Interviews

Unless you are a casual Android user, you surely have heard of some Android teams like CyanogenMod, AOKP, Team Gummy (R.I.P.) and Team EOS. Development teams are great because you get a bunch of great minds to come together and really improve upon an OS. This is what makes Android great to tinker with. New ideas are thrown around and implemented and old ideas are enhanced and improved upon. Every once in a while, a new team steps into the community with bright new ideas and the brain power to make those ideas a reality. One of those new teams is the Android Developer Alliance, who were nice enough to sit down with me and chat.
